Warren Chan: The nanoparticle biological identity & protein corona

In this NMIN lecture, “The nanoparticle biological identity & protein corona: Challenges, opportunities, & future research directions,“ Dr. Warren Chan discusses the role of the biological identity (e.g. protein corona) in mediating cellular interactions, delves into the current state of research, and reflects on future research directions and commercial opportunities for this burgeoning area of nanomedicine. Dr. Chan is Professor, Canada Research Chair in Nanobioengineering & Director, Institute of Biomedical Engineering (BME), at the University of Toronto.
